Timezone in La Colpa
La Colpa is situated in the timezone America/Lima, which operates on a UTC offset of -5 hours. Peru does not observe daylight saving time, maintaining this standard time throughout the year. As a result, there are no changes to the clock, making it straightforward for scheduling purposes.

Attractions and Activities in La Colpa
La Colpa is a small district located in the region of La Libertad, Peru. This area is characterized by its agricultural landscape, with local farming being a significant aspect of daily life. The region is known for its production of various crops, including sugarcane and other agricultural products, which play a vital role in the local economy and culture.
While La Colpa may not be widely recognized for specific tourist attractions, it shares the rich cultural heritage of the La Libertad region, which is known for its traditional festivals and local customs. The nearby city of Trujillo, famous for its colonial architecture and archaeological sites like Chan Chan, provides a broader context for visitors interested in exploring the historical and cultural significance of the area.
